I replaced the flow switch on my pentair swg 40 and it still reads low salt. Salt tests fine at 3600. It’s 8 years old. Hours test show at 20%. No scale on fins. If it’s only around 2,000 hours of operation I can’t seem to think I need a new one (unless that’s off as my rough estimate would put the unit at 5,000-6,000 hours). Do I need to fork over the 1200 for a new one?
 
8 years is a good run for a SWG.

You can cut the white wire to the temperature thermistor which will default it to 76F to confirm that a bad temperature sensor is not throwing your salinity off.
